The classical Hadamard three circle theorem is generalized to complete Kähler manifolds. More precisely, we show that the nonnegativity of the holomorphic sectional curvature is a necessary and sufficient condition for the three circle theorem. A vector bundle E on a projective variety X is called finite if it satisfies a nontrivial polynomial equation with integral coefficients.
